Many times we are called upon to clean out our parents' home for placement on the market. In most cases, it is the very house where we grew up, and memories are present in each and every room. Usually the basement, attic, and garage are the easiest places to start the process, as was the case in this home. The family was able to go through these three areas and identify items they wished to keep for themselves, donate (for a tax deduction), or just let go. |

The basement, attic, and garage were completely cleared of all extraneous items. Two areas in the back corner of the basement and garage were set aside to house items that were to be kept or donated, leaving all the other space in each area open and available for workmen to come in and paint and repair as needed. Potential buyers can now see how spacious each area is and begin to envision how they could use the space for their own family. |
